๐ Strawberry Basil Lemonade Recipe
Ingredients:
โข 1 heaping cup fresh strawberries (hulled and halved)
โข ยฝ cup fresh lemon juice (from about 3โ4 lemons)
โข ยผ cup honey or sugar (adjust to taste)
โข 3 cups cold water
โข 4โ5 fresh basil leaves
โข Ice cubes
โข Lemon slices + whole strawberries (for garnish, optional)
Instructions:
- Make the strawberry puree: In a blender, combine strawberries with ยฝ cup water and blend until smooth. Strain through a fine mesh sieve to remove seeds (optional).
- Mix the lemonade: In a large pitcher, stir together lemon juice, sweetener, and the strawberry puree. Mix until the honey or sugar dissolves.
- Add water and basil: Pour in the remaining water. Tear the basil leaves slightly (to release their oils) and stir them in.
- Chill: Let the lemonade rest in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es to let the flavors infuse.
- Serve: Pour over ice, and garnish with lemon slices, strawberries, and a fresh basil sprig.
๐ Savvy Tip: For an elegant twist, top off each glass with sparkling water or club soda for a fizzy finish. Hosting a summer brunch? Add a splash of elderflower or pour over frozen fruit instead of ice.
๐ฟ Why It Works
This lemonade is the perfect blend of sweet, tart, and herbal โ and itโs completely customizable. Strawberries add natural sweetness, while basil brings a fresh, slightly peppery balance. It feels fancy, but it’s made with simple ingredients and takes just minutes to pull together.
And hereโs a bonus: lemons and strawberries are packed with vitamin C, and basil has antioxidants โ so youโre nourishing your body while treating your taste buds.
๐น More Flavor Ideas to Try:
โข Swap basil for mint for a more traditional summer flavor.
โข Use raspberries instead of strawberries for a bolder color and tangier taste.
โข Make an iced tea version by adding brewed (and cooled) green or black tea.
โข Freeze leftovers in popsicle molds โ they make amazing frozen summer treats!
